Do you burn calories gaming?

Yes, gaming does burn calories, especially competitive or active games, with studies showing gamers can burn hundreds of calories in a few hours, comparable to light exercise like sit-ups, as intense focus and quick reactions raise heart rates, but it's not a replacement for dedicated physical activity. Men might burn around 210 calories per hour and women 236 calories, depending on game intensity, with higher numbers for more engaging titles like FIFA or Warzone.

How many calories do 20,000 steps burn?

Walking 20,000 steps burns roughly 600 to over 1,000 calories, but the exact amount varies significantly with your weight, walking speed, and terrain, with heavier people and faster paces burning more. For example, a heavier person might burn closer to 1,000 calories, while a lighter person could burn around 600-800 calories for the same effort, with intensity (like incline) boosting calorie expenditure.

How many sit ups to burn 1000 calories?

To burn 1000 calories with sit-ups, you'd need an extremely high number, likely thousands (potentially 5,000+), because sit-ups are poor calorie burners, generally only yielding 0.5-1 calorie per 10 reps, meaning 100 sit-ups burn only ~10 calories, so focus on more intense cardio or strength training for significant calorie expenditure, as sit-ups build core strength better than fat loss, according to BetterMe and other sources.

What is the 3-3-3 rule for losing weight?

The 3-3-3 rule for weight loss is a simple, habit-based framework focusing on consistency: 3 balanced meals a day, 3 bottles of water by 3 p.m. (about 1.5-2 liters total), and 3 hours of physical activity per week, usually broken into shorter sessions like 30-minute walks most days, emphasizing consistent movement and hydration for metabolic support without rigid calorie counting. Another version focuses on meal composition: 3 protein sources, 3 carb sources, 3 fat sources for meals, while a workout version involves 3 exercises, 3 rounds, 3 times a week.
